b/tests/e2e/PROVIDER_CACHE.md new file mode 100644 index 00000000000..280132d0940 --- /dev/null +++ b/tests/e2e/PROVIDER_CACHE.md @@ -0,0 +1,27 @@ +# Shared provider-response cache + +`E2E_PROVIDER_CACHE=1` enables automatic response reuse in the live E2E mode. Standard OpenAI and Anthropic model registrations use the provider edge. Existing custom API bases, named credentials, mocked models and realtime WebSocket deployments keep their existing routing. Other provider protocols remain live + +The edge caches complete successful POST responses for `/v1/chat/completions` and `/v1/messages`, including streams. Unsupported endpoints pass through. It matches the method, original URL, effective outbound headers (including authentication and HTTP-library defaults), body presence and exact body bytes using a full keyed digest. It sends the same prepared request used for matching. No prompts, random markers, JSON values or credentials are normalized away + +An eligible miss calls the provider. A complete successful response is stored immediately even if a later test assertion fails. Provider errors, malformed responses, truncated streams and cancelled captures are not stored. Cache reads, writes and lease failures fall through to normal provider behavior; they introduce no provider retry. An already-started response cannot be restarted after a delivery failure + +Recordings are shared across workers and builds through dedicated Redis, separate from the candidate's own cache. They expire 86,400 seconds after capture starts, based on Redis time. Reads never extend expiry. There is no scheduled recapture: the next miss calls the provider again. Bounded coordination reduces duplicate concurrent calls, but slow or failed captures may lead to extra live calls after the wait expires + +## Configuration + +The trusted runner receives: + +- `E2E_PROVIDER_CACHE`: `1` to enable, `0` to use the normal live path +- `E2E_PROVIDER_CACHE_REDIS_URL`: authenticated dedicated Redis URL +- `E2E_PROVIDER_CACHE_HMAC_KEY`: dedicated secret containing at least 32 bytes +- `E2E_PROVIDER_CACHE_NAMESPACE`: shared environment namespace, independent of build and candidate revision +- `E2E_PROVIDER_CACHE_METRICS_DIR`: optional per-process counter artifact directory + +Do not give cache credentials to candidate deployments. Counter artifacts contain no recorded payloads or credentials. Hits count shared-cache responses; upstream attempts count actual forwards from the edge. Existing application-cache observations still count requests arriving at the edge, including shared-cache hits + +Tests that require real provider timing, limits or state use `@pytest.mark.provider_live`. The marker keeps newly registered models on live routes without weakening their assertions. Ordinary assertion failures still fail E2E. The shared cache does not modify provider response IDs or make the proxy aware of replay + +## Qualification + +`tests/code_coverage_tests/test_provider_cache.py` exercises local HTTP providers and disposable real Redis. CI runs these checks with the existing provider-edge and replay harness tests. These component checks do not establish Buildkite deployment, full-suite cross-build reuse or a genuine 24-hour expiry observation; those require separate runtime evidence diff --git a/tests/e2e/conftest.py b/tests/e2e/conftest.py index b1a75d5f862..829c84910a9 100644 --- a/tests/e2e/conftest.py +++ b/tests/e2e/conftest.py @@ -22,7 +22,6 @@ from typing import Final import pytest import requests - from e2e_config import ( CONTROL_PLANE_BASE_URL, FIXTURE_DIR, @@ -41,6 +40,7 @@ from idp import Identity, Keycloak, keycloak_from_env from junit_properties import attach_result_properties from lifecycle import ProxyClientProvider, ResourceManager from models import TeamNewBody, UserNewBody, UserNewResponse +from provider_cache_routing import LIVE_PROVIDER_REQUIRED from provider_edge import replay_leftover_error from proxy_client import ProxyClient, build_proxy_client @@ -85,6 +85,7 @@ def jwt_identity(idp: Keycloak, resources: ResourceManager, proxy: ProxyClient) def pytest_configure(config: pytest.Config) -> None: + config.addinivalue_line("markers", "provider_live: requires actual provider timing, limits or state; bypass shared cache") config.addinivalue_line( "markers", "e2e: live test that requires a running proxy and real provider keys", @@ -192,11 +193,13 @@ def _proxy_fail_reason() -> str | None: return None +@pytest.hookimpl(tryfirst=True) def pytest_runtest_setup(item: pytest.Item) -> None: """Hard-fail `e2e`-marked tests unless a proxy answers its liveness probe.
